Output c6556a43c89186601deecb20f57eb847beb3946bca94e7a61294c5d9d3ee7728:7

value
316178567
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 577f735a6b0deb0b4212fb06ba474b075efec0cd OP_EQUALVERIFY OP_CHECKSIG
address
18yeU7W1NPxfofHpfePnSXVZzPPu1f6dpM
transaction
c6556a43c89186601deecb20f57eb847beb3946bca94e7a61294c5d9d3ee7728
confirmations
505039
spent
true